How did you do your fringe? It looks better than the OG pattern!


PandaLillie

* I attached first two strands to the ends to leave 4 hanging. I skipped two stitches then repeat. Then I went back across and tied them together taking two strands from one on the left and two from one on right. I hope that makes sense lol
